Maintenance Technician

RHF
SEATTLE, WA , US
Full-time

Responsibilities :

  • Conduct routine inspections of premises and equipment to identify maintenance needs.
  • Perform maintenance tasks such as repairing, troubleshooting, and servicing mechanical and electrical systems.
  • Address plumbing and HVAC issues, ensuring proper functionality.
  • Repair and maintain building structures, including carpentry and painting tasks.
  • Respond promptly to maintenance requests and emergencies.
  • Maintain accurate records of maintenance activities and repairs.
  • Collaborate with other team members to prioritize and execute maintenance projects.
  • Perform preventive maintenance to extend the life of equipment and systems.
  • Ensure compliance with safety regulations and company policies.
  • Ensure al preventative maintenance is scheduled and completed
  • Schedule and oversee all vendor work on the property.

Requirements :

  • High school diploma or equivalent; technical certification or vocational training is a plus.
  • Proven experience as a Maintenance Technician or similar role.
  • Strong knowledge of mechanical, electrical, and plumbing systems.
  • Proficiency in using maintenance tools and equipment.
  • Ability to read technical manuals and drawings.
  • Problem-solving skills and a proactive approach to addressing maintenance issues.
  • Excellent communication and teamwork abilities.
  • Physical stamina to perform tasks that involve lifting, bending, and standing for extended periods.
  • Attention to detail and a commitment to maintaining a clean and organized work environment.
  • Valid driver's license and reliable transportation.
